Grasping Active Pharmaceutical Ingredients in Medications

Active pharmaceutical ingredients, or APIs, are the fundamental components within medications that produce the desired therapeutic effects. These chemical substances directly interact with the system to treat a specific condition. Understanding APIs is crucial for comprehending how medications work. Furthermore, knowledge of APIs helps doctors make informed decisions about amount, potential relationships with other drugs, and possible adverse reactions.

  • To illustrate, ibuprofen is an API used to reduce pain and inflammation. It works by blocking the production of prostaglandins, chemicals that contribute to pain and swelling.
  • Similarly, amoxicillin is an API used to treat bacterial infections. It targets bacteria by interfering with their cell wall synthesis.

Compounding Pharmacy Solutions for Unique Patient Needs

Customized medications offer a tailored approach to healthcare, addressing the unique requirements of patients who may not benefit from commercially available drugs. Dispensaries specializing in compounding meticulously formulate customized prescriptions based on individual needs, offering modifiable dosages, alternative delivery methods, and specialized ingredients. This provides optimal therapeutic outcomes and enhances patient adherence.

  • Additionally, compounding allows for the creation of medications in specific forms, such as topical creams, suppositories, or oral solutions, catering to patients with difficulties swallowing pills or experiencing skin sensitivity.
  • Specifically, compounding can be used to create hypoallergenic medications for patients with allergies, alleviate the taste of bitter medications, and provide personalized treatment options for children or elderly individuals who require different dosages.

Ultimately, compounding pharmacy solutions play a crucial role in providing patient-centered care, ensuring that every individual receives the most effective and personalized treatment possible.

Prescription Medications: Safety, Efficacy, and Regulatory Oversight

The pharmaceutical industry plays a vital role in modern healthcare, offering numerous prescription medications to treat diverse illnesses. Confirming the safety and efficacy of these drugs is paramount. Stringent regulatory oversight by organizations such as the Food and Drug Administration (FDA) is essential in this process. Before a medication can be authorized, it undergoes rigorous testing and evaluation to demonstrate its benefits outweigh potential risks. Medical investigations are performed to assess the drug's effectiveness and safety profile in humans.

  • Additionally, regulatory agencies oversee the manufacturing process of prescription medications to ensure adherence to quality standards.
  • Continuous evaluation systems are in place to detect any unforeseen adverse effects after a drug has been made available to the public.
